GREENEVILLE, Tenn. --- The Tusculum College women's tennis team
dropped only four games on the afternoon as the Pioneers defeated visiting
Lees-McRae College Saturday afternoon at the Nichols Tennis Complex. The Pioneers improve to 6-5 on the year.
Tusculum swept all three doubles
points including an 8-0 pro set win at No. 3 doubles by Danae Valderrama and Jennifer Sparks over the LMC pair of Brittney Sherrill and Rebecca
Payne.
In singles play, Tusculum lost
only two games as Claudia Bolivar, Maria Nevarez,
Amanda Pike, Bronwyn Hartley and Sparks by identical 6-0, 6-0 scores.
